we have been together for 3 years now. We are getting married in the summer. He kissed another girl, and says he got caught up in the moment. He told me on his own that he kissed her because he wanted to change and felt guilty hiding it every time he talked to me. His reason for hiding it was because he didnt want to lose me. He's very sorry for what he did and he wants another chance. I kno for a fact he loves me alot but its very hard for me to forgive him. but i dont wanna lose him. we been through alot together and i dont want to throw all that away over a meaningless kiss with another girl. but im afraid if i forgive him he'll think its ok to do it again. Please help me out. I love him alot and he loves me bak. i kno he feels guilty for what he did. i dont know what to do. i want to forgive him but would that be the right thing to do?. so should i forgive him or break up wit him??

I'd postpone the wedding if I was you. There have to be consequences or he'll think he can get away with ANYTHING as long as he says he's sorry and that he got caught up in the moment.

Because, truth be told, if he was that concerned about your feelings and really wanting to keep you then he should have been able to resist so simple a temptation.

Postpone the marriage and see how you feel about things next year. If he squawks and screams about it being "unfair" of you to delay the marriage, dump him. It's his fault and he should take the delay like a man. Similarly, if he gives you any more reason to not trust him then dump him. But if he accepts the delay gracefully and works hard to regain your trust then I'd give him another chance.

Leaving him might be a little over the top if you both love each other. It's very unfortunate when these things happen but the fact that he told you the truth says a lot. It was wrong of him to do those things so its up to you how you react. You might give it some time (away from him) so you can evaluate how you feel, and so he knows that he really hurt you. Focus on how he acts in the meantime. If he becomes defensive and tries to justify what he did, its not a good sign. If he remains apologetic and sad then he is probably genuinely sorry.
